Why Layout Matters in Home Renovation


When it comes to home renovation in Cincinnati, the layout is the foundation of your design. The layout impacts how you use the space daily, from how you move between rooms to how natural light flows into each area. A well-designed layout considers the flow of traffic, the placement of furniture, and even how rooms connect to one another. Poor layout choices can lead to wasted space, cluttered areas, and an uncomfortable atmosphere in your home.

Step 1: Assess Your Current Space


Before diving into design choices, take time to assess your existing space. Start by noting the dimensions of your rooms, ceiling heights, and any architectural features that might affect your plans, such as load-bearing walls or large windows. If you’re working with a historical home in Cincinnati, be mindful of the original design elements, which could be charming and valuable to preserve.

Step 3: Optimize the Flow Between Rooms


Flow is one of the most important aspects of any home layout. The way you move between spaces can greatly affect how comfortable and functional your home feels. Ideally, you want a layout that allows for smooth transitions between rooms without unnecessary hallways or awkward spaces.

For instance, in a home renovation Cincinnati project, many homeowners opt to remove barriers between the kitchen, dining, and living areas to create an open-concept space. This not only enhances the flow but also improves sightlines, which can make the space feel larger.

Step 4: Maximize Storage Without Sacrificing Space


One of the most common challenges in home renovation is finding ways to store items without overcrowding the space. In Cincinnati, where homes can vary from small urban apartments to larger suburban houses, maximizing storage is key to maintaining a functional layout.

You don’t always need extra closets or bulky furniture to store your belongings. Creative solutions like built-in shelves, under-stair storage, or multi-functional furniture can help. Consider how often you use certain items and prioritize storage areas accordingly. For example, if you’re renovating a kitchen, adding cabinets that reach the ceiling can provide much-needed storage space.

Step 5: Consider Lighting and Ventilation


A functional layout isn’t just about how rooms are arranged; it’s also about how those rooms are lit and ventilated. Natural light can make a huge difference in how spacious and welcoming your home feels. During your home renovation in Cincinnati, think about where windows are placed and whether you can improve natural light flow. For example, consider adding larger windows or skylights in areas that lack sufficient sunlight.

Ventilation is also important, especially in areas like the kitchen and bathrooms. Make sure your layout allows for proper airflow to prevent humidity buildup and ensure the overall comfort of your home.

Step 6: Incorporate Flexibility Into Your Design


A good home layout should be flexible enough to adapt to changing needs. For example, a spare bedroom may be used as an office now, but in the future, it might become a nursery or guest room. Consider how your layout can evolve by incorporating movable furniture or creating multi-purpose spaces.

Many Cincinnati homeowners choose to incorporate open shelving or sliding doors, allowing them to reconfigure rooms or make spaces more versatile. Flexibility in design can future-proof your home and make it more adaptable to any changes.
